There should be a connection to ground on the W/B wire when the AC switch is toggled on. If not it will not engage the clutch. I would recommend checking continuity between each point in that circuit.
If you ground the W/B wire does the clutch engage?

If you don't have ground on the W/B wire but do on the B/Y wire when the AC switch is turned on then you have an issue in the controller. The fact that the AC switch LED does not illuminate tends to indicate this. You are toggling the AC switch on and off while checking correct? Have you induced or connected a ground to the W/B wire and checked if the clutch engages?
